WebJun 28, 2024 · If you’re using silver solder – that is, solder with 45 percent silver or higher – to connect copper to steel you must always use an acid-based flux. If you’re brazing with a copper-phosphorous brazing rod, including those with silver, flux is not 100 percent mandatory when working with lines that are also copper, though it’s recommended. WebNov 25, 2024 · Most of the heat from the torch goes into turning the water to steam, so the copper won’t get hot enough to melt the solder. Stop the trickle of water with a pipe plug. … WebYou must heat the copper tubing and fitting for about ten or fifteen seconds before touching the solder wire to the hot copper. The HOT copper will melt the solder, not the torch. To …

WebBrush flux onto the inside of fitting the outside of pipe, then slide the pipe and fitting together. Ignite the torch. Heat the entire joint evenly until the solder can be melted by the heat of the joint, rather than the flame of the torch. Move the torch to the far end of the joint. Touch the solder to the joint.
